In 2002, a train full of Hindu pilgrims departed from Ayodia and returned to Gujarat. At a small station (which is also the seat of the Muslim community), there were conflicts between Hindus and Muslim hawkers. During the conflict, Muslims burned a carriage and dozens of Hindus who had not had time to escape died. This incident turned into an ethnic conflict, and war broke out between Hindus and Muslims in Gujarat and surrounding provinces. Those neighbors who once lived next to each other suddenly lost their rationality and slashed all the minorities in the community. As the government of Gujarat was in power by Hindus, it even played a role in adding fuel to the fire during the ethnic conflict, encouraging Hindus to slaughter Muslims with inaction and hints. The human tragedy of ethnic conflict is staged again.

After the massacre, people woke up in reflection: How did you suddenly lose your mind? They were ashamed of their actions, so the religious conflict in India suddenly entered a period of relaxation. This is much like the relaxation of Sikhism and Indian society after the conflict broke out in 1984. At this time, it was also the period of fastest economic development in India, so people optimistically estimate that the most chaotic period of Indian society has passed.

--Excerpt from Guo Jianlong "India, Floating Subcontinent"
